Woodland Grove is a traditional, purpose-built and elegant care home with 72 private, en-suite rooms. Individual care plans are tailor-made to meet each resident’s personal needs, supported by our dedicated team of highly trained staff. Superb facilities and a diverse range of daily activities make Woodland Grove a beautiful place to call home.

No need to worry about unexpected bills. The fee you pay at Oakland Care is all-inclusive, covering:

  • The costs of your 24-hour personal care
  • Your accommodation in a fully furnished en-suite room
  • Utilities such as heat and light, as well as Council Tax
  • Food (breakfast, lunch and dinner), snacks and drinks, including wine and house alcohol at mealtimes and events
  • Telephone line rental and UK calls
  • Housekeeping and laundry undertaken on the premises (excluding dry cleaning)
  • Television licence, for personal use
  • Wi-Fi connection
  • All in-house entertainment and activities and local outings
  • Use of the home’s recreational facilities
  • A personalised physiotherapy assessment that also considers pre-existing conditions
  • Chiropody (once every 8-12 weeks)
  • Hairdressing (once per week)
  • Social outings

Our fees are all inclusive.
